Understanding Rose Water

What Is Rose Water?

Rose water, derived from the Rosa damascena or Rosa centifolia flowers, is a fragrant liquid known for its therapeutic properties. It has been used for centuries in skincare and medicinal practices due to its an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and soothing properties.

The Benefits

Reducing Eye Puffiness and Dark Circles

The natural astringent properties of rose water make it an excellent remedy for reducing eye puffiness and dark circles. Soak a cotton pad in chilled rose water and gently apply it to closed eyelids for a refreshing and rejuvenating effect.

Preventing Inflammation and Redness

The anti-inflammatory properties of rose water make it an effective solution for reducing redness and inflammation around the eyes. Applying a cotton pad soaked in rose water can help alleviate irritation and soothe sensitive skin.

Enhancing Skin Elasticity

Regular use of rose water around the eyes can contribute to improved skin elasticity. It aids in toning the delicate skin, reducing the appearance of fine lines, and promoting a youthful glow.
